Emily Irizarry
"I am a student at the University of North Florida, getting a bachelors in fine art. I am specializing in PDP with a focus in oil painting and printmaking. My work is focused on women and the female form and also the political environment in which surrounds us. While they may seem opposite sides of the spectrum I feel they intertwine with my personal views and focuses. I want to represent the empowerment of femininity and the female form. That those things should not count against us if we so choose to accentuate and flaunt that part of who we are. It stands alongside my views of feminism and equal rights in taking control of things you love about yourself and showcasing them as strengths whole others would consider them weaknesses. I also focus on the political climate that surrounds me and how I view the world because of it."
"There is currently too much mess and ugliness going around and often it is hard to express how what is going on is effecting us. I portray those feelings through art, not just to get hem off my chest but to give the viewer a front row seat into what is going on and give them a chance to see things through me eyes. It is not as a means of propaganda but a means to make an impact on an individual whether they feel the same way or not."
